What Is Papaya Orange Juice?
Papaya Orange Juice is a naturally sweet, pulp-rich beverage made by blending fresh papaya with orange juice. You can make it with whole fruit or fresh-squeezed juice and adjust the texture and flavor to your preference. Some variations include a splash of lime juice, a pinch of ginger, or even a handful of mint leaves for an herbal twist.
Because both fruits are rich in vitamins and antioxidants, this juice is not only tasty but also a nutritional powerhouse. It’s especially popular in tropical regions and among wellness-focused foodies looking for alternatives to sugary, store-bought beverages.

Simple Papaya Orange Juice Recipe
Here’s a quick and easy recipe to get you started.
Ingredients:
- 1 cup ripe papaya, peeled and chopped
- 1 cup freshly squeezed orange juice (about 2–3 oranges)
- ½ teaspoon grated ginger (optional)
- 1 tablespoon lime juice (optional)
- Ice cubes (optional)
- Mint leaves for garnish
Instructions:
- Add papaya and orange juice to a blender.
- Blend until smooth. Add a little water if the consistency is too thick.
- Strain the juice if you prefer it pulp-free.
- Stir in lime juice and ginger if using.
- Serve chilled over ice with mint garnish.
You’ve just made a delicious glass of Papaya Orange Juice in under 5 minutes!

Variations of Papaya Orange Juice
One of the best things about Papaya Orange Juice is its versatility. Here are some fun variations to try:
1. Papaya Orange Ginger Juice
Add a knob of ginger for a spicy, digestion-boosting kick.
2. Tropical Twist
Add pineapple, mango, or coconut water for a tropical blend.
3. Green Boost
Blend in spinach or kale for added fiber and iron.
4. Smoothie Style
Include yogurt or almond milk for a thicker, creamier drink.
5. Herbal Infusion
Add mint or basil leaves for an herbal undertone.
6. Frozen Pops
Pour into molds and freeze for healthy, fruity popsicles.

Tips for Choosing the Best Ingredients
- Papaya: Look for orange skin and a slight give when pressed. Avoid green, underripe papayas.
- Oranges: Freshly squeezed juice is best. Valencia and navel oranges work well.
- Ginger & Lime: Use fresh, not powdered, for best flavor.
- Organic Produce: Whenever possible, choose organic to avoid pesticide residues.

Frequently Asked Questions
Q: Can I make Papaya Orange Juice ahead of time?
A: Yes! Store in an airtight glass bottle in the fridge for up to 48 hours.
Q: Is it okay to drink Papaya Orange Juice every day?
A: Absolutely. Just ensure it’s part of a balanced diet and avoid adding sugar.
Q: Can I freeze it?
A: Yes, freeze in ice cube trays or popsicle molds for a refreshing treat.
Q: Does it interact with medications?
A: In rare cases, papaya enzymes may interfere with certain medications. If unsure, consult your doctor.
